The monitoring of fetal EEG during labour can assist in identifying the effects on the fetus of anaesthetic and other drugs administered to the mother. Additionally it assists in detecting inadequate cerebral perfusion. One unsuccessful and one successful method are described of removing fetal EKG from the fetal EEG signal, so enabling the Cerebral Function Monitor to be used to monitor the fetal EEG. Examples of results are given.
